On tax reform, take a page from Ronald Reagan

Written by Teunis Felter

Just as Ronald Reagan’s landmark 1986 bipartisan tax reform increased simplicity, fairness and economic efficiency by broadening the tax base and reducing rates, today tax reform has the potential to help American families and the economy. Properly designed, revenue-neutral reforms could help to offset the dramatic increases in inequality that have taken place over a generation, repair a business tax system that globalization has rendered dysfunctional, reduce uncertainty and promote growth.
